This transaction is used to correct errors thathave resulted from automatic goods move-ments. Automatic goods movement errors oc-cur, for example, when a production order isbeing confirmed and components are back-flushed from a storage location that does nothave the required quantity in inventory. Se-lection criteria include plant, storage location,material, error date from/to range, and otherrelevant inventory document data. The out-put is an aggregated list of goods movementerrors. Once the error has been reviewed andresolved, the inventory movement will beprocessed.
This transaction is used to create a dangerousgoods master, which is an extension of thematerial master. The master record containsinformation required to carry out automaticchecks in the Sales and Distribution (SD) andMaterials Management (MM) processes andgenerate documents required by local regula-tors. Input an existing material master and thedangerous goods regulation code (in Custom-izing, the dangerous goods regulation codecontains the mode of transport and validityarea, for example, Germany). Enter the mas-ter data and save.
Use this transaction to change a dangerousgoods master previously created using Trans-action DGP1.
Use this transaction to display a dangerousgoods master previously created using Trans-action DGP1.
Use this transaction to display a list of danger-ous goods master data from the dangerousgoods master data table DGTMD. Input selec-tion includes material, regulation key, andvalid from/to date range. The output can belisted by material, mode of transport cate-gory, and validity area; all change statuses,which are identified by validity area orchange number, can be read at the item level.The display layout can be changed and savedas a default, according to your requirements.
This transaction is used to create a resource-related billing request, which is a special typeof billing based on resources consumed bythe organization. For example, a consultingcompany agrees to sell services based on timespent on a sales order. Time is recorded to thesales order, and then the customer is billedbased on the hours charged to the sales order.This transaction generates the resource-re-lated billing request, which is followed up byan actual billing document. Input the sales or-der and line items, pricing date, posting date,and posting period and execute.

Use this transaction to create an intercom-pany billing document for the purposes ofbilling one company for using the resourcesof another company code in order to bill anend customer. In this scenario, an intercom-pany sales order is generated for using the re-sources. Once time and/or expenses arecharged to a project, the selling companycode can bill the end customer. The next stepis to use this transaction to create the inter-company billing request, which is then fol-lowed by an intercompany billing document.This in turn facilitates the payment from theselling company code to the company codeproviding the resources. Input the intercom-pany sales document, period, fiscal year, andposting to date; choose a sales price; and press(Enter). On the Sales screen, expand theitems and chose the cross-company line itemand then chose Billing Request and thenclick Yes to confirm the billing request cre-ation.
This transaction is used to create a resource-related billing request for multiple resourceusage postings across multiple sales orders.Resource-related billing is a special type ofbilling based on resources consumed by anorganization. For example, a consulting com-pany agrees to sell services based on timespent on a sales order. Time is recorded to thesales order, and then the customer is billedbased on the hours charged to the sales order.This transaction generates a resource-relatedbilling request, which is followed by the ac-tual billing document. Input the sales orderand line items, pricing date, posting date, andposting period and execute.
This transaction uses the sales informationsystem application to report sales activities.This transaction specifically uses informationstructure S001 (Customer). An informationstructure contains characteristics (fields thatare reported on) and key figures (results of thereport). This transaction has the followingstandard delivered characteristics: sold-to,sales organization, division, distribution chan-nel, and material. The standard delivered keyfigures include, for example, sales order val-ues and quantity, open sales order values,sales order cost, returns order values, billingvalues, and sales order subtotal values. Inputcustomer, sales area, and posting period from/to range and execute. Multiple display func-tions are available, including the ability toswitch the drilldown order, the characteristickey and value, and the key figures related totop percentage values.
This transaction is similar to TransactionMCTA but focuses on the material characteris-tic and uses information structure S004 (Ma-terial). An information structure containscharacteristics (fields that are reported on)and key figures (results of the report). Thistransaction has the following standard deliv-ered characteristics: material, sales organiza-tion, division, and distribution channel. Thekey figures include, for example, sales ordervalues and quantity, open sales order values,sales order cost, returns order values, billingvalues, and sales order subtotal values. Inputcustomer, sales area, and posting periodfrom/to range and execute. Multiple displayfunctions are available including the ability toswitch drilldown order, the characteristic keyand value display, and key figures related totop percentage values.

You can use this transaction to replace a workcenter in a task list. In the selection screen,enter the plant, key for the work center, andkey for the new work center. If a key date isnot entered, all operations where the workcenter is used are displayed. You can restrictthe selection by entering additional search cri-teria such as key date, status, usage, plannergroup, and material number.
Transaction CA85 has disadvantages such aspoor performance and lack of background pro-cessing capability; hence, the new TransactionCA85N (Mass Replacement: Work Center) isavailable. While using Transaction CA85N, ifthe target work center is same as the sourcework center but contains different validities forcost centers and activity types, the system is-sues an error message. Refer to SAP Note1454538 – CA85N: Incorrect error message CR061 for information on how to correct this er-ror message. You can refer to SAP Note 543400– New: Mass Replacement Work Center formore details about Transaction CA85N.
You can use this transaction to create, change(edit and maintain), and display the master dataof classes. You can create a new class either di-rectly or with a template. Classification of equip-ment, functional locations, and bills of materials(BOMs) are often used to identify additionaltechnical specifications for maintenance objects.The Product Structure Browser displayswhich objects are assigned to the class. In the ini-tial screen, follow the menu path Environment �Product Structure to display the Product
Structure Browser.
You can use this transaction to create as-builtconfigurations from production data. An as-built configuration describes the structure of aserialized assembly that has been produced orthe history of the individual components usedin the product. An as-built configuration canbe created after each individual order or atthe end of the production of a finished prod-uct.
You can use this transaction to create the datathat identify the maintenance bill of material(BOM). Maintenance BOMs are differentfrom production or engineering BOMs be-cause maintenance BOMs contain only itemsrelevant to maintenance. The maintenanceBOM has two main functions: structuring atechnical object (equipment or functional lo-cation assemblies) and spare parts planning inthe order. While creating the BOM, you canspecify the effective date as well. You can en-ter the plant if you want the BOM to be effec-tive in this specific plant. If the material forwhich you are creating the BOM has a mate-rial type that cannot be combined with theBOM usage, an error message is displayed.
You can use this transaction to edit and main-tain the bill of materials (BOM) data. If theBOM you are maintaining is allocated to mul-tiple plants, the changes are relevant to allplants. If you process a BOM that is part of aBOM group with a change number, you mustuse a change number to process all BOMs inthe group.

Information about technical objects to bemaintained can also exist in the form of elec-tronic documents (for example, maintenancemanuals, instructions, pictures). Documentsare managed using the SAP logistics commoncomponent “document management system.”These documents are associated with andlinked to various Plant Maintenance (PM) ob-jects. You can use this transaction to create adocument info record. A document info re-cord stores all the data required to processand manage a document. For the specifieddocument number and document type, youcan use Transaction CV03N (Display Docu-ment) to display the document info recordand original application files that belong tothe document.
You can use this transaction to edit and makechanges to a document. Prior to making changesto a document, the following must be consid-ered:
� If the document is in “Locked” or “Original in Process” status, many of the fields in the document cannot be changed. Hence, the document status must be changed prior to making edits to the document info record.
� All changes to the document will generate a workflow event.
� Changes to the document are not histori-cal. If you prefer to maintain historical sta-tus, creating a newer version of the docu-ment is recommended.
� If preferred, during customizing of the cross-application components, you can specify whether change documents must be created for all changes to the document info record.
For the specified document number and doc-ument type, you can use this transaction todisplay the document info record and originalapplication files that belong to the document.
You can use this transaction to search and finddocuments. You can use any of the followingsearch criteria: data from the document inforecord, text elements, signature data, and soon. You can create a task list to describe a se-quence of individual maintenance activitiesthat must be performed at regular intervals.The next few transactions describe how tocreate, maintain, and display equipment tasklist, general task list, and functional locationtask list.
You can use this transaction to create an equip-ment task list. In the initial screen, enter theequipment and, if required, an existing profilenumber. If an equipment task list exists, theTask List overview screen is displayed. If notask list exists, the General Overview screen isdisplayed. Using the equipment task list, youcan define and manage maintenance tasks foryour equipment in one central place. The equip-ment task list can be used to prepare mainte-nance plans and orders as well. You can com-bine several task lists into one group. Within thegroup, a unique sequential number called agroup counter is assigned to each individualequipment task list.
Spare parts and material components can alsobe included in maintenance task lists. The ba-sis for component parts list is the relevantmaintenance bill of materials (BOM) definedin the Assembly field on the task list header. Ifno assembly is referenced on the task list,
